      ab: This study will investigate the effects of technology, digital information competence, and metadata usage on the learning and research outcomes of Vietnamese university students, specifically at Vietnam National University, Hanoi (VNU). Using a quantitative approach, data were collected from 400 students via a purpose-designed 24-item questionnaire on a 5-point Likert scale. To analyze the data and test the research hypotheses, partial least squares structural equation modeling (PLS-SEM) was employed. The PLS-SEM results indicate that all hypotheses were accepted, confirming statistically significant relationships among the factors. Technology (TEC) exerts the strongest and most direct effect on Digital Information Competence (DIC), with the highest t-value of 32.523, indicating that technology use is foundational for strengthening digital information competence. The study also confirms that both digital information competence and technology positively influence Metadata Usage (MU). Addressing gaps in prior research, this work integrates three separate lines of inquiry into a single model and focuses on a multidisciplinary student population in Vietnam. The findings have important practical implications, suggesting that universities should prioritize not only technological investment but also training in metadata usage and digital information competence for students.
